India has successfully commissioned the country's largest energy storage project, a 40 MW / 120 MWh battery energy storage system (BESS) connected to a 152 MWh solar photovoltaic p...
India has successfully commissioned the country's largest energy storage project, a 40 MW / 120 MWh battery energy storage system (BESS) connected to a 152 MWh solar photovoltaic p...